## Formula sandbox tuning

User-supplied formulas in Gridmoor execute inside a restricted interpreter with hard ceilings on time, memory, and call depth. Reviewers should confirm any change to these ceilings is justified in the PR description, since raising them widens the abuse surface. Defaults were chosen from production traces. The current limits are as follows.

limits module of tafog-fawip:
WEIGHTS = {
    "julix": 57,
    "lamys": 992,
    "kasvan": 209,
    "quenok": 750,
    "alddor": 259,
    "oliath": 1009,
    "wenix": 815,
}

/*
 * SCANWIRE_HANDSHAKE_TIMEOUT_MS
 *
 * Heads up, plugin folks: this is the max time we'll wait for a
 * Scanwire barcode unit to ack the handshake before we fall back to
 * keyboard-wedge mode. Don't bump it past 4000 — the Pellidore POS
 * shell kills unresponsive integrations at 5s flat and you'll get
 * blamed for the freeze. If you see flaky handshakes on older firmware,
 * reproduce with debug logging on and quote the build token printed
 * right below this comment.
 */

trace token, faduf-hahig: htk4_b8f9

Subject: Catalogue import handover

Hi there — quick heads-up before you start next week. The Fernleaf library catalogue import is changing hands; the nightly MARC batch and the dedupe scripts are included. Docs are in the shared drive under "imports". Don't push changes until you've synced with the new owner. Going forward, that responsibility belongs to the person below.

account owner for bawip-tahag: Raleth Quenok

Ticket: KVX-1482 — False-positive rate drift in the Pellwood bloom filter fronting the Quarrel KV store. After the shard split last week, observed FP rate rose from 0.9% to 4.1%, causing unnecessary backend reads. Suspect the filter wasn't resized during rehash. Marta is bisecting configs. The regression first appears in the following build.

pipeline stamp: htk31_f769b577b3028a4e9958e5bb8d1259a